This paper introduces MEVITA, an open-source bipedal robot built entirely from e-commerce components assembled using sheet metal welding. Reinforcement learning in simulation, combined with Sim-to-Real transfer, allowed MEVITA to demonstrate robust walking behavior across varied terrains. The design emphasizes minimizing the number of components and ensuring easy assembly.

The research presents a novel approach to designing and constructing a bipedal robot using readily available e-commerce components and sheet metal welding. The successful demonstration of various walking behaviors on different terrains, enabled by reinforcement learning, further strengthens the study. The open-source nature of the project is also a significant contribution to the field. Although limitations regarding stability and lack of detailed comparisons exist, the innovative design and successful implementation warrant a rating of 4.
